At the June 28 DAWN meeting a new Point of Unity was passed unanimously. The DC Anti-War Network will now officially stand and work against torture. We will align ourselves with other groups that work to stop torture around the globe. Per the note-taker at the meeting: "Item 4. Level I: Addition to DAWN Points of Unity, including on the web page:
"DAWN stands opposed to torture and aligns with other groups to work
against torture in the United States and worldwide."
Passed unanimously."
